Monthly Cost of Living
😐A single person spends $1,257 per month in Salto vs $1,025 in Minas, rent included.
😐A couple spends around $1,893 per month in Salto vs $1,637 in Minas, rent included.
😐A family of three spends $2,529 per month in Salto vs $2,248 in Minas, rent included.
😐Salto costs about 23% more than Minas,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.
📊Both Salto and Minas are more affordable than the global median – Salto6% lower, Minas23% lower.
